SR 14 Both Directions (per WSDOT just now)
Description: Closure on SR 14 both directions from milepost 56 near Cook-Underwood Road to milepost 65 near Hood River Bridge Road due to a brush fire. Access detour:
Eastbound travelers can detour at Bridge of the Gods to I-84 then onto Hood River Bridge.
Westbound travelers can detour at Hood River Bridge to I-84 then onto Bridge of the Gods.
Use caution in the area beginning at 6:28 am on July 3, 2023 until further notice.
Last updated: 07/04/2023 09:17 AM
